Output 653615dc4f2a145e1ea47abc779cc19d5294908d2eb01da1f7237cf0dfc743d7:12

value
102887
script pubkey
OP_0 OP_PUSHBYTES_20 947354df159a7fdb16adfb82d6741bd43252fbb8
address
bc1qj3e4fhc4nflak94dlwpdvaqm6se997ac28c9d9
transaction
653615dc4f2a145e1ea47abc779cc19d5294908d2eb01da1f7237cf0dfc743d7